Hey everyone,

 

 I just purchased all of the gear and screens for active target but my old fortrex is done and needs to be replaced. 

In a perfect world I'd like the ultrex but the price tag has me questioning if I should just get another fortrex.  

I was told by a friend that I "need" the ultrex for active target, and I will swear if I get the fortrex, but I have my doubts and can't see why the fortrex (for half the cost) wouldn't work well. 

Thoughts?

I don’t understanding why your friend believes that you need an Ultrex for active target. I have an Ultrex and MEGA Live. Initially, I mounted Live on the Ultrex, but it was annoying. I paid for features like Target Lock and Autopilot on my trolling motor but I couldn't use them and Mega Live simultaneously. I solved this problem by adding Target Lock last fall and mounting the MEGA Live transducer to it.

 

Another issue with trolling motors such as the Ultrex that rely on a motor instead of a cable for steering is that they limit how quickly you can steer. This is also true for Target Lock, which is controlled by a motor. While not a significant problem, there are times when I would like to steer faster.  For example, tracking an individual fish in open water requires constant turning to keep up with the fish's position. Although I don't pursue individual fish often, I wish my Live transducer was on a cable steer motor when I do.

 

The Ultrex is a great trolling motor but is not ideal as a Live imaging mount.

like spot lock? I use It with Livescope. I see what I want to throw It, orient myself to It, hit spot lock, throw at target. 
 

I don’t HAVE to see what I’m casting at 100% of the time. 
 

btw I use spot lock way more to just find structure I like rather than find and watch individual fish take my bait. Although that’s pretty cool too
